Reactions of Lithiated Methoxyallene with Oxime Derivatives – Formation of 1,2-Oxazines and Functionalized Isoxazole Derivatives
In a brief exploratory study we investigated the reactions of lithiated methoxyallene with different oxime derivatives. With E-benzaldehyde oxime a 3,6-dihydro-2H-1,2-oxazine derivative was isolated in low yield, being the result of an overall [3+ 3] cyclization. The reaction of lithiated methoxyallene with phenylhydroximoyl chloride provided a moderate yield of an isoxazole derivative that incorporated two benzonitrile oxide-derived moieties. In situ generated a-nitrosostyrene and lithiated methoxyallene combine to the expected primary 1,4-addition product which could be trapped by O-methylation. On the other hand, the primary adduct cyclized after aqueous work-up to give a vinyl-substituted isoxazole derivative in good yield. Mechanisms for the formation of the products are presented. The discovered new routes to 1,2-oxazine or isoxazole derivatives seem to be restricted to aryl-substituted electrophiles.
